The Ready-to-Drink (RTD) Beverage market is a segment of the beverage industry that includes pre-mixed, non-alcoholic drinks that are packaged and ready for consumption. RTD beverages are typically sold in cans, bottles, and cartons, and are often marketed as a convenient and refreshing alternative to traditional soft drinks. RTD beverages come in a variety of flavors, including fruit, tea, coffee, and energy drinks.
RTD beverages are popular among consumers due to their convenience and portability. They are often seen as a healthier alternative to traditional soft drinks, as they are typically lower in sugar and calories. RTD beverages are also popular among athletes and fitness enthusiasts, as they are often fortified with vitamins and minerals.
